July Weather in Saint-Andre, Canada

Last updated: June 18, 2025

In July, the average temperature in Saint-Andre, Canada hovers around 17°C (62°F), with a minimum of 9°C (49°F) and a maximum reaching up to 26°C (80°F). Expect about 59 mm (2.3 in) of precipitation spread over 10 days, contributing to an average humidity level of 81%. Plan accordingly for a mix of mild warmth and potential rain!

July UV Index in Saint-Andre

In Saint-Andre in July, the maximum UV index is 8, which corresponds to a very high Exposure Category. This means that the time to burn is only 15 minutes. For more detailed information, you can refer to the Hourly UV Index in Saint-Andre.

How July Weather in Saint-Andre Compares to Other Months

Weather in Saint-Andre var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in Saint-Andre,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Saint-Andre,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-9°C (16°F)85 mm (3.3 inches)93%low
February Weather-9°C (17°F)72 mm (2.8 inches)92%moderate
March Weather-4°C (25°F)88 mm (3.4 inches)90%moderate
April Weather1°C (35°F)126 mm (5.0 inches)87%high
May Weather7°C (46°F)104 mm (4.1 inches)82%very high
June Weather14°C (57°F)76 mm (3.0 inches)77%very high
July Weather17°C (62°F)59 mm (2.3 inches)81%very high
August Weather17°C (62°F)59 mm (2.3 inches)83%very high
September Weather13°C (55°F)85 mm (3.3 inches)85%high
October Weather8°C (46°F)165 mm (6.5 inches)87%moderate
November Weather0°C (32°F)118 mm (4.6 inches)87%low
December Weather-6°C (22°F)94 mm (3.7 inches)90%low
